Cold Weather Advisory issued December 13 at 2:21AM EST until December 15 at 11:00AM EST by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
* WHAT...Very cold wind chills as low as 10 to 15 below zero expected.
* WHERE...Portions of east central and southeast Indiana, northeast and northern Kentucky, and central, south central, southwest, and west central Ohio.
* WHEN...From 7 PM this evening to 11 AM EST Monday.
* IMPACTS...The cold wind chills as low as 15 below zero could result in hypothermia or frostbite if precautions are not taken.
Winter Weather Advisory issued December 13 at 12:42AM EST until December 14 at 7:00AM EST by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
* WHAT...Snow expected. Total snow accumulations between 3 and 5 inches.
* WHERE...Portions of east central Indiana and central and west central Ohio.
* WHEN...From 1 PM this afternoon to 7 AM EST Sunday.
* IMPACTS...Plan on slippery road conditions.

It's only a drill
Photo by Mark Pummell/The Daily Standard

Students at Celina West Elementary School react to the statewide tornado drill and siren test in Ohio this morning at about 9:50 a.m. The students moved from their classrooms to the hallway, sat down, hunched over and covered their heads. Mercer County has a total of 23 tornado and warning sirens. There are five in Celina, four in Jefferson Township, three in Coldwater, two in St. Henry and nine others near villages, reports Mike Robbins of the Homeland Security and Emergency Management office in Celina.
